Two Dates Calculator
Calculate the exact duration between two dates with precision.
Visual Time Distribution
Comparison of total days vs. equivalent weeks and months.
| Unit of Time | Total Count |
|---|---|
| Days | 0 |
| Weeks | 0 |
| Months (Approx) | 0 |
| Years (Approx) | 0 |
What is a Two Dates Calculator?
A Two Dates Calculator is a specialized digital tool designed to measure the precise span of time between two specific points on a calendar. Unlike simple subtraction, a professional Two Dates Calculator accounts for the complexities of the Gregorian calendar, including leap years, varying month lengths (28, 29, 30, or 31 days), and inclusive versus exclusive date counting.
Who should use it? This tool is essential for project managers tracking deadlines, HR professionals calculating employee tenure, legal experts determining statute of limitations, and individuals planning significant life events. Common misconceptions include the idea that every month has 30 days or that leap years don't significantly impact long-term calculations. A Two Dates Calculator eliminates these errors by providing mathematically sound results.
Two Dates Calculator Formula and Mathematical Explanation
The mathematical logic behind a Two Dates Calculator involves several steps to ensure accuracy across different calendar cycles. The core formula can be expressed as:
Duration = (End Date – Start Date) + (Inclusive Adjustment)
To derive the breakdown of years, months, and days, the algorithm follows these steps:
- Calculate the total difference in milliseconds.
- Convert milliseconds to total days (1 day = 86,400,000 ms).
- Determine full years by checking the date anniversary for each year.
- Determine remaining full months by checking the day-of-month anniversary.
- Calculate the remaining days.
| Variable | Meaning | Unit | Typical Range |
|---|---|---|---|
| Start Date | The beginning of the period | Date | Any valid calendar date |
| End Date | The conclusion of the period | Date | Must be ≥ Start Date |
| Inclusive Flag | Whether to count the final day | Boolean | Yes / No |
| Leap Year | Adjustment for Feb 29th | Days | 0 or 1 per 4 years |
Practical Examples (Real-World Use Cases)
Example 1: Project Management
A project starts on January 15, 2023, and must be completed by May 20, 2024. Using the Two Dates Calculator, the manager finds the duration is 1 year, 4 months, and 5 days. This allows for precise resource allocation and milestone setting.
Example 2: Employment Tenure
An employee joined a firm on March 10, 2015, and resigned on August 15, 2023. The Two Dates Calculator shows a total tenure of 8 years, 5 months, and 5 days. This exact figure is used for calculating pension benefits and severance pay.
How to Use This Two Dates Calculator
Using our Two Dates Calculator is straightforward and designed for maximum accuracy:
- Step 1: Select the "Start Date" using the calendar picker.
- Step 2: Select the "End Date". Ensure this date is after the start date.
- Step 3: Toggle the "Include end date" checkbox if you want the calculation to be inclusive (common in rental agreements or insurance policies).
- Step 4: Review the "Total Duration" highlighted in the green box.
- Step 5: Analyze the breakdown in the intermediate results section for years, months, and weeks.
- Step 6: Use the "Copy Results" button to save the data for your records.
Key Factors That Affect Two Dates Calculator Results
Several variables can influence the output of a Two Dates Calculator:
- Leap Years: The presence of February 29th adds an extra day to the total count every four years, which the Two Dates Calculator must handle.
- Month Lengths: Since months vary from 28 to 31 days, the "Months" result depends heavily on which specific months are spanned.
- Inclusivity: Standard calculations are often exclusive (End – Start). However, many business contracts require inclusive counting (End – Start + 1).
- Time Zones: While this Two Dates Calculator uses local calendar dates, crossing time zones can technically shift the "day" boundary.
- Calendar Systems: This tool uses the Gregorian calendar, which is the international standard. Other calendars (Julian, Hijri) would yield different results.
- Daylight Savings: While usually not affecting date-to-date counts, it can impact hour-based calculations during the transition days.
Frequently Asked Questions (FAQ)
Related Tools and Internal Resources
- Date Duration Calculator – A tool for measuring specific time intervals.
- Business Day Calculator – Calculate duration excluding weekends and holidays.
- Age Calculator – Find your exact age in days, months, and years.
- Time Unit Converter – Convert between days, hours, seconds, and more.
- Countdown Timer – Create a live countdown to a specific future date.
- Calendar Math Tool – Add or subtract days from a specific date.